Output 89e6a00c9aacfc1099d52be5f089f642d770180c10a2a7d35a9955a87f0497c3:5

value
20954038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06845b13bb7e956fc5cf791949e27f56ab12424e OP_EQUAL
address
M8Vcqpb3GAH5EP2EMCxbP4TCGqR48UhJWP
transaction
89e6a00c9aacfc1099d52be5f089f642d770180c10a2a7d35a9955a87f0497c3
spent
true